Founded in 1878, Caleres—originally known as Brown Shoe Company—is a global footwear company comprised of some of the world’s most loved brands, including Famous Footwear, Sam Edelman, Naturalizer, Dr. Scholl's, and Allen Edmonds. With over 145 years of craftsmanship, Caleres is driven by a passion for fit and a mission to inspire people to feel great… feet first.
About the Role
Plans and directs the design, implementation, communication, and administration of benefits programs in support of the Total Rewards philosophy and benefits strategies. Leads the development of new initiatives to establish competitive and cost-effective benefits programs while ensuring compliance with governmental regulations.
Responsibilities
- Design and execute health, welfare, and retirement programs that support company culture, associates, and total rewards strategy.
- Manage the administration of benefits programs in partnership with vendors.
- Collaborate with vendors and external partners, managing contract performance to ensure maximum value of services.
- Evaluate and lead global benefits renewals.
- Create communications campaigns to align with program rollout or refresh, keeping employees engaged.
- Determine key performance indicators for benefit programs and track baseline utilization to measure plan effectiveness.
- Assess and optimize all global benefits strategies on an ongoing basis.
- Manage the execution of annual open enrollment, including related events, communications, and system configuration.
- Assist in the development and monitoring of benefit plan budgets.
- Oversee the preparation and submission of required government filings.
- Manage the funding and accounting of benefit plans.
- Provide analysis and interpretation of plan costs and trends.
- Stay abreast of industry trends, best-in-class methodologies, and technologies to determine applicability to Caleres’ strategic direction.
